The Hisense 55" U6 Series TV is a strong choice for gamers looking for a 4K TV that delivers smooth and vibrant visuals. Its native 144Hz refresh rate is excellent for fast-paced games, reducing motion blur and making gameplay feel more responsive. The inclusion of AMD FreeSync Premium helps prevent screen tearing, which is great for immersive gaming. The Mini-LED panel with up to 1000 nits of peak brightness and 600 local dimming zones offers impressive contrast and deeper blacks, enhancing HDR effects through support for Dolby Vision IQ and HDR10+. This means games with dark scenes or bright highlights will look more detailed and realistic.

Audio-wise, the built-in subwoofer and Dolby Atmos support provide rich sound without needing extra speakers. Connectivity options like Bluetooth, Ethernet, HDMI, USB, and Wi-Fi 6 are modern and versatile, ensuring easy connection to gaming consoles and accessories. The TV’s AI upscaling is useful if you play older or lower-resolution games, making them look better on the 4K screen.

This TV is well-suited for gamers who want sharp visuals, smooth action, and solid sound from a 55-inch screen, especially at a value-oriented price point.

The Panasonic Z85 Series 55-inch OLED TV is a strong choice for gaming thanks to its crisp 4K Ultra HD resolution and a smooth 120Hz refresh rate, which helps games look sharp and fluid. It supports advanced gaming features including HDMI 2.1, Variable Refresh Rate (VRR), AMD FreeSync Premium, and NVIDIA G-SYNC, all of which reduce screen tearing and lag, making gameplay more responsive and enjoyable. The OLED panel provides excellent contrast and vibrant colors, contributing to a visually immersive experience when gaming or watching movies.

HDR support is robust, with multiple formats like HDR10, HDR10+, Dolby Vision IQ, and HLG, and intelligent brightness adjustments help maintain vivid picture quality even in different lighting conditions. Sound quality is enhanced by Dolby Atmos and a built-in subwoofer, delivering clear and immersive audio, which is a nice bonus for gamers who don't want to invest in extra speakers. The TV's smart Fire TV platform offers easy access to apps and streaming, adding convenience beyond gaming.

The Panasonic Z85 is well-suited for gamers seeking a large, high-quality OLED display with advanced gaming features and excellent HDR performance. It remains a compelling option for those wanting a premium gaming experience with vibrant visuals and immersive sound.

Buying Guide for the Best 55 Inch TV For Gaming

When choosing a 55-inch TV for gaming, it's important to consider several key specifications to ensure you get the best experience. Gaming TVs need to have certain features that enhance the visual quality, responsiveness, and overall performance. By understanding these specs, you can make an informed decision that suits your gaming needs and preferences.
ResolutionResolution refers to the number of pixels that make up the picture on the screen. The higher the resolution, the sharper and more detailed the image. For gaming, a 4K resolution (3840 x 2160 pixels) is ideal as it provides a highly detailed and immersive experience. If you have a next-gen gaming console or a powerful gaming PC, a 4K TV will allow you to take full advantage of the graphics capabilities. However, if you are using older consoles or don't prioritize ultra-high definition, a Full HD (1080p) TV might suffice.
Refresh RateThe refresh rate is the number of times the TV updates the image per second, measured in Hertz (Hz). A higher refresh rate results in smoother motion, which is crucial for fast-paced gaming. Standard TVs have a refresh rate of 60Hz, but for gaming, a 120Hz or higher refresh rate is recommended. This reduces motion blur and provides a more fluid gaming experience. If you play a lot of action-packed or competitive games, opting for a higher refresh rate will be beneficial.
Input LagInput lag is the delay between pressing a button on your controller and seeing the corresponding action on the screen. Lower input lag is essential for a responsive gaming experience. For gaming, look for a TV with an input lag of 20 milliseconds (ms) or less. Some TVs have a 'Game Mode' that reduces input lag, making them more suitable for gaming. If you play competitive or fast-paced games, minimizing input lag should be a priority.
HDR (High Dynamic Range)HDR enhances the contrast and color range of the TV, making the picture more vibrant and realistic. This is particularly important for gaming, as it can make game environments look more lifelike and immersive. There are different HDR standards, such as HDR10, Dolby Vision, and HLG. For the best gaming experience, look for a TV that supports HDR10 or Dolby Vision, as these provide the most significant improvements in picture quality. If you enjoy visually stunning games, HDR support is a must-have feature.
ConnectivityConnectivity refers to the ports and wireless options available on the TV. For gaming, HDMI ports are crucial as they connect your console or PC to the TV. Look for a TV with multiple HDMI 2.0 or HDMI 2.1 ports, as these support higher resolutions and refresh rates. HDMI 2.1 is particularly important for next-gen consoles, as it supports features like Variable Refresh Rate (VRR) and Auto Low Latency Mode (ALLM). Additionally, having USB ports and Bluetooth can be useful for connecting accessories. Ensure the TV has enough ports to accommodate all your gaming devices.
Panel TypeThe panel type affects the TV's picture quality, viewing angles, and response time. The most common types are LED, OLED, and QLED. LED TVs are generally more affordable and offer good picture quality. OLED TVs provide superior picture quality with perfect blacks and excellent viewing angles, making them ideal for gaming in dark rooms. QLED TVs, which use quantum dots, offer bright and vibrant colors, making them great for well-lit rooms. Choose a panel type based on your gaming environment and picture quality preferences.
